Freigeben über


ID3D12Device9-Schnittstelle (d3d12.h)

Stellt einen virtuellen Adapter dar. Diese Schnittstelle erweitert ID3D12Device8 , um Methoden zum Verwalten von Shadercaches hinzuzufügen.

Vererbung

ID3D12Device9 erbt von der ID3D12Device8-Schnittstelle .

Methoden

Die ID3D12Device9-Schnittstelle verfügt über diese Methoden.

 
ID3D12Device9::CreateCommandQueue1

Erstellt eine Befehlswarteschlange mit einer Ersteller-ID.
ID3D12Device9::CreateShaderCacheSession

Erstellt ein -Objekt, das Zugriff auf einen Shadercache gewährt und möglicherweise einen vorhandenen Cache öffnet oder einen neuen erstellt.
ID3D12Device9::ShaderCacheControl

Ändert das Verhalten von Caches, die intern von Direct3D oder vom Treiber verwendet werden.

Anforderungen

Anforderung Wert
Unterstützte Mindestversion (Client) Windows 10 Build 20348
Unterstützte Mindestversion (Server) Windows 10 Build 20348
Zielplattform Windows
Kopfzeile d3d12.h

Weitere Informationen